
CAS 106554-16-9
:Tris[2-(perfluorodecyl)ethyl] Phosphate
Description:
Tris[2-(perfluorodecyl)ethyl] phosphate, with the CAS number 106554-16-9, is a chemical compound that belongs to the class of organophosphate esters. It is characterized by its three phosphate groups esterified with perfluorinated alkyl chains, specifically those containing a decyl group. This structure imparts unique properties, such as high thermal stability and resistance to degradation, making it suitable for various applications, including as a flame retardant and plasticizer in polymers. The presence of perfluorinated groups enhances its hydrophobicity and lipophobicity, contributing to its effectiveness in reducing flammability and improving the durability of materials. However, the environmental persistence and potential bioaccumulation of perfluorinated compounds raise concerns regarding their ecological impact. As such, the use and regulation of Tris[2-(perfluorodecyl)ethyl] phosphate are subject to scrutiny in light of ongoing research into the safety and environmental implications of perfluorinated substances.
